Home Security Vacation Planning

home Security

As spring and summer approach, many families will be leaving their homes empty for a few weeks to enjoy a little R&R. Don’t let your opportunity to enjoy some quality time away with the family become an opportunity for burglars to invade your home.

A well-planned vacation includes a plan for minding the fort while you’re away. Some common strategies include: getting a house sitter, having a neighbor bring in mail and newspapers, leaving on some lights or putting some on timers, and possibly getting a security system.

The old standby in this situation seems to be: lights-timers-neighbors. Any plan is better than no plan at all, and ensuring that your papers and mail don’t pile up is a good place to start. Having a trusted neighbor take care of these items and possibly even park a car in your driveway can be a great help. Shedding a little light on the subject property can’t hurt either.

Be careful with the lights though, when overdone it could actually send the message that the lights are on, but nobody’s home. If your home has a sprinkler system that is on a timer, you may want to set it up to operate intermittently while you’re away too. Just be sure to abide by any watering restrictions that might be in place.

While leaving some lights on or utilizing items on timers might give the impression that someone is home. Someone actually being in the home is a much better idea. Try to get a trusted friend or family member to temporarily take up residence in your home while you are away. Your home will truly be more secure and you will be able to enjoy your time away that much more knowing that it is.

If you already have a security system, use it.

If you haven’t used it in quite some time and cannot remember exactly how, consult your instruction manual or your security company well in advance of your departure date. This will help you to avoid a great deal of last minute frustration. If you plan to have a house or pet sitter, ensure that they know how to operate the security system too. You should also communicate your vacation plans with your monitoring company. Let them know things like: the dates you will be away, your return date, if the house will be vacant or the numbers for your house or pet sitter, if there is to be one. Some companies may also let you request immediate dispatch if the home is to be completely vacant. This may temporarily bypass the need for a verification call to the home, which is required by most police departments and could speed up the dispatch process. You may also want to give them the numbers where you will be staying for ease of contacting you should they need to.

If you don’t have a security system and are thinking about getting one, plan ahead. Security companies get a rush of business around vacation time too. The best companies will book up just like the best hotels at the beach. You should do your research and shopping well in advance to ensure that you can get your security system installed in time and that you get to use your alarm company of choice.

With a little planning you can enjoy your dream vacation without the worry of a burglary nightmare.

Tips For Travel Booking For Family Vacation

family tips

When you are planning to book tickets for your vacation, you need to remember several things. To ensure that you can book the exact trip you want, you need to make sure that you can get an appropricate deal and that the spot you choose is suitable for your family members.

 

Here are some basic tips to help you with your family vacation needs.

 

The first thing to consider with travel booking and a family vacation is when the best time for your family to travel is. You will need to decide if you want to travel in the spring, fall, winter, or summer. Summer is most popular with most families as this is when the children are not in school.

 

Think about the amount of time that you are going to be traveling prior to choosing your destination.

You do not want to spend too much of your time on travel. A good basis is that you should travel for no more than ten percent of your trip. So if you are traveling for 48 hours round trip in the car you will want to go on vacation for a minimum of 20 days or nearly three weeks.

 

The next thing that is helpful with travel booking a family vacation is to know the purpose of your trip. Do you want to go sightseeing? Are you interested in a specific event? Would you like to visit someone special? All of these things can make a difference in your travel choices.

 

You will then be able to start planning your trip and choosing a destination. When you choose your destination there are many things that you can think about. One of these is to think about places that could be beneficial for your children.

These could include special historic landmarks or visiting museums. This is a great way to introduce learning into your family fun time.

 

You should then create a vacation budget. Keep in mind what all things should cost and make yourself a budget and plan on how you will not overspend while you are traveling.
